Amazon.com Book Description (ISBN 1859419275, Paperback)
This book provides a critical exposition of the major features of the UKs constitution in a straightforward, readable textbook suitable for undergraduate use. The text draws together constitutional theory, history, law and practice in a manner designed to provide a comprehensive yet intelligible text. It covers the background and fundamental concepts which formed this countrys constitution, and examines the role of every layer of government, from local government to the European Community and Union.
